Coverage starts where contracts leak cash.

01

Discounts and rate cards

Misapplied rates, excluded SKUs, regional adjustments, tier thresholds, and price increases.

02

Credits and commitments

Expiring credits, commitment drawdown, ramp schedules, minimums, overage rates, and stranded value.

03

Reserved capacity

GPU reservation utilization, batch placement, committed-capacity gaps, and idle pools.

04

Renewals and notice windows

Renewal timing, uplift caps, forecast mismatches, true-up exposure, and negotiation leverage.
